Court orders FIR against cop, 2 others for cheating

New Delhi, Aug 17 (PTI) A court here has directed DelhiPolice to lodge an FIR against a head constable and two othersfor carrying out unauthorised construction in a property ownedjointly by the complainant and the cop. "Investigation is required to ascertain the truth of thematter… SHO of Jaitpur police station is directed to lodgeFIR under relevant provisions of law on the complaint of therevisionist and investigate the matter," Additional SessionsJudge (ASJ) Raj Kumar Tripathi said. The court asked the police to lodge FIR against HeadConstable Mahesh Sharma and his two brothers Ajay and Manoj onrevision plea of complainant Angad Sharma against the order ofa magisterial court which had dismissed his plea against themfor forging documents and beating him up. "Revisionist has levelled serious allegations against therespondents in his complaint which are required to be investigated by the police," the ASJ said. According to the complaint, Angad, along with the headconstable, had purchased a property in Hari Nagar extension inWest Delhi in 2010 for Rs 14.85 lakh for the purpose ofinvestment, but soon the cop started residing in it withouthis consent. It was alleged that in 2015, the cop, without informingor discussing with the complainant, demolished the property,began carrying out unauthorised construction and transferredthe electricity meter in the name of his brother Manoj. The complainant approached the police but to no avail, itsaid, adding that he also clicked pictures of the propertysite from his mobile phone as evidence against them but he wasbeaten by the accused cop’s brothers and framed in a falsecase of molestating the constable’s wife. Angad approached a magisterial court for lodging of FIRagainst the accused but his plea was dismissed. He then moved a revision plea before the sessions courtseeking FIR against the accused, saying probe was required inthe case to recover his mobile phone which was allegedlysnatched and the source of forgery of documents of theproperty was to be found out. He had sought registration of FIR under sections 323(voluntarily causing hurt), 341 (wrongful restraint), 356(assault in attempt to commit theft), 506(threatening), 420(cheating), 467/468/471(forgery) and 120B(criminal conspiracy)of the IPC.
